About The Position

We are seeking a LICENSED SENIOR ARCHITECT to join the team in our AUSTIN, TX office. This experienced professional is a fully competent architect in all conventional aspects of architecture , responsible to direct, coordinate and oversee all technical project team efforts to deliver an accurate and complete set of project documents. This is a hybrid position, requiring a minimum of 3 days per week onsite at our Austin, TX office.

Requirements

  • Substantial experience in developing details and providing technical and design support in the preparation of Design Development for commercial projects required.
  • Strong knowledge of code and demonstrated awareness of code limitations.
  • Excellent communication, organizational, and collaborative skills
  • Self-motivated; ability to work independently and in a team environment to coordinate and maintain positive working relationships with other technical staff, outside consultants, and clients
  • Able to effectively and positively provide direction and lead architectural staff
  • Strong skills and talent in SketchUp modeling, AutoCAD, and Revit/BIM.
  • Must be able to handle multiple concurrent projects and/or deadlines.
  • Licensed & registered Architect in the state of TX
  • 8+ years of experience
  • Well-versed in IBC and Texas amendments, Type V construction; accessibility requirements; occupancies A, B, & M
  • Completion of Bachelor's in Architecture or Master's in Architecture from an NAAB accredited program.
  • Commitment to their own professional growth.
  • Must be legally authorized to work for any employer in the United States without any restrictions.
  • Please note that visa sponsorship is not offered for this position.

Responsibilities

  • Successfully coordinate all project efforts through all phases of design and development to ensure the most efficient and cost-effective execution for the most complex projects.
  • Present directly to the client on technical and design solutions.
  • Direct Schematic Design and Construction.
  • Document and monitor adherence to project requirements.
  • Supervise the teams' design and technical delivery.
  • Monitor budgets and schedules and maintain project documentation.
  • Develop and represent lead technical viewpoint on projects.
  • Coordinate with Project Management, other Architects and consultants on appropriate technical solutions and product strategies.
  • Deliver a complete, accurate and well- coordinated set of project documents for quality control review with minimal comments.
  • Mentor architectural staff.
  • Demonstrate professionalism, effective communication, and collaboration with clients, staff, and resource teams.
